Concentrated solar power

OverviewCSP with thermal energy storageComparison between CSP and other electricity sourcesHistoryCurrent technologyDeployment around the worldCostEfficiency

In a CSP plant that includes storage, the solar energy is first used to heat molten salt or synthetic oil, which is stored providing thermal/heat energy at high temperature in insulated tanks. Later the hot molten salt (or oil) is used in a steam generator to produce steam to generate electricity by steam turbo generator as required. Thus solar energy which is available in daylight only is used to generate electricity round the clock on demand as a load following power plant or solar peaker pl
